The position requires a Bachelor's degree in Mechanical Engineering or related field, plus 10+ years of experience in SAP S4/HANA and MES Solution architecture, demonstrated experience as an SAP PP or PEO Solution Architect, and a proven track record of successfully installing PP/PEO in previous projects.
In-depth knowledge of the SAP PP-PEO module is required, including production shop floor order management, production planning, product costing, production scheduling, logistics execution, configuration, customization, and integration with other systems.

Designs and develops electric vertical takeoff aircraft
Archer designs and develops electric vertical takeoff and landing (eVTOL) aircraft aimed at transforming urban transportation. Their aircraft operate by taking off and landing vertically, which allows them to navigate congested city environments efficiently. Archer targets urban commuters, city planners, and transportation networks, offering eco-friendly solutions to improve urban mobility. Unlike traditional transportation methods, Archer's eVTOLs provide a sustainable alternative that reduces environmental impact. The company generates revenue through the sale of its aircraft and may also offer air taxi services in the future. Archer's goal is to lead the shift towards sustainable air mobility, making urban commuting more efficient and environmentally friendly.
